If you have Simple Green around, you can use it. I fill about 1/4 of my spray bottle with SG, then fill it up with water. Add a squirt of glycerin sometimes. :-)

I use the same one as JudyW. I really like it. Also I have the recipe for the blender pen refill. I haven't made it yet but I plan to real soon. It is:
2 t. glycerin
4 t. distilled water
1/4 t. rubbing alcohol
The person that had it on here that I got it from said you could use an eye dropper to fill it.

I've been using Judyw's recipe for over a year on my rubbah and clear stamps. I love it and it does a great jobs on most inks. Be sure you buy distilled water and shake before each use. Do not use anything with alcohol or lanolin on your stamps, it is bad.
I didn't buy a spray bottle. I use an empty Panteen spray bottle - washed and rinsed well. Same type bottle for recipe below.
I also use the Simple Green recipe for rubbah that stains easy. It does a good job of cleaning them. I emailed the Simple Green Co. and was told to use a much lower ratio of SG than Amy's recipe. Here's my recipe:
2 Cups Distilled Water
2 1/2 Tblsp. Simple Green

Yeah, I tried that, too, but it didn't clean the way I wanted it to! LOL I've been using it for nearly a year, and I have not noticed any ill effects on my rubber stamps. Apparently it's a risk I'm willing to take, since I keep using it!
I do use Ultra Clean and StazOn cleaner off and on. And I like to use a microfiber cloth to wipe the stamps off occasionally.
I also use just glycerin on my stamps if I see the rubber starting to turn a chalky white. I rub the glycerin in the crevices and let it soak in , I sometimes rub it off or I keep it there until I am ready to use the stamp and then I clean it off before inking my stamp. My stamps have never looked better.
